Non-partisan by policy
We are not neutral about facts, and we are not aligned with any party. Every side gets the same treatment: the drama gets named, the substance gets explained, and the reader is trusted to decide.
Entertainment framing, factual content
The popcorn scale rates how dramatic a story is, never how true or how important it is. A 5-bucket rating is a comment on the spectacle. Nothing on this site should be read as a claim that politics is only entertainment — the stakes are real, and the explainers exist to say so.
Corrections
Errors get corrected at the top of the affected story, with the change described plainly. Write in and we will fix it faster than a press secretary can issue a clarification.
